Action item: During the Garnet Deck incident, the occupancy feed for the Larkspur Commons garage reported stale counts for nearly four hours before anyone noticed. Support should now verify feed freshness at the start of every shift, comparing the last-updated timestamp against a ten-minute threshold. The full verification checklist, with screenshots and escalation criteria, lives on the internal wiki page linked below.

wiki page, tahaf-tajog: https://jira.ordindyn.corp/pipeline

Building access — badge system migration. Thornquay House is moving from the old Keyline readers to the new Aldergate panels over the next fortnight. Contractor badges issued before the cutover will stop working floor by floor, starting with level 4. Until your replacement badge is issued, the stairwell doors and the level 2 workshop accept a temporary keypad entry using the code below.

staff pass of kawip-hawef = bdg-QLP-2

Finance Review Summary — Retirement of the Norvick Line

For branch managers. The Norvick line is confirmed for retirement at year end. Remaining stock to be cleared at approved discounts; no further reorders. Write-downs are within forecast. Service obligations run another eighteen months. The confidential note on successor plans follows below.

confidential, kagup-bafog: Fraaxax Group is in early talks to buy Soroxox Group for about $343.8 million. The Olidor launch date is June 14, and nothing goes to the press before then. Legal wants the Aldmirek Logistics term sheet signed before July 23.

**Ticket DV-LOCK: DiffSpan vault locked after failed plugin sync**

The DiffSpan extension vault locked itself after three failed signature checks on the large-file chunk renderer. Plugin authors cannot publish updates until the vault is reopened. Per Marrowtide policy, recovery requires the passphrase held by the plugin platform team. For external authors tracking this: unlock is scheduled for tomorrow. The recovery passphrase is recorded below.

unlock words, hahip-baduf: holwyn-istath-julvan